## Lung Cancer Score: Navigating Healthcare Access in Philadelphia's 19109

Considering a move to Philadelphia, especially the vibrant heart of ZIP Code 19109, requires careful consideration of healthcare access. This is particularly crucial for individuals with or at risk for lung cancer, a disease demanding swift and consistent medical attention. This write-up, a "Lung Cancer Score" assessment, delves into the transportation landscape surrounding 19109, offering insights into the accessibility of lung cancer-specific healthcare. The goal is to illuminate the realities of getting to vital appointments, treatments, and support services, making informed decisions easier.

The 19109 ZIP code, encompassing Center City Philadelphia, boasts a unique blend of urban density and historical charm. Its central location places residents within easy reach of numerous healthcare facilities, including those specializing in lung cancer care. However, the ease of access hinges significantly on the chosen mode of transportation. A well-developed transportation network is the lifeblood of healthcare access, especially for those battling a serious illness.

**Driving Times: A Network of Roads**

For those preferring the autonomy of personal vehicles, navigating the roads is a primary consideration. From 19109, several major hospitals with lung cancer treatment centers are within a reasonable driving distance. The drive to the Hospital of the University of Pennsylvania (HUP), a leading cancer center, typically takes 10-20 minutes, depending on traffic. Access is primarily via **South Street**, **Market Street**, or **Chestnut Street**, connecting to **South 34th Street**.

Similarly, driving to Thomas Jefferson University Hospital (Jefferson), another prominent facility, usually takes 5-15 minutes, utilizing **Broad Street** or **15th Street** to reach **10th Street**. Traffic congestion, a common Philadelphia phenomenon, can significantly extend these times, especially during rush hour. **Interstate 95 (I-95)**, running along the eastern edge of the city, offers a faster route for some, but its proximity to the Delaware River and frequent construction can cause delays.

**Public Transit: A City on the Move**

Philadelphia's public transportation system, operated by the Southeastern Pennsylvania Transportation Authority (SEPTA), provides a robust alternative to driving. The city's public transit is a cornerstone of healthcare access, especially for those without vehicles or who prefer to avoid the stress of driving and parking. The **Market-Frankford Line (Blue Line)**, with numerous stations throughout 19109, offers direct access to Jefferson Station and convenient connections to other hospitals.

The **Broad Street Line (Orange Line)** provides another crucial artery, running north-south and serving areas near HUP. Many bus routes also traverse the area, including the **Route 2, Route 7, Route 17, Route 21, Route 33, and Route 42**, offering access to various medical facilities. SEPTA strives to provide accessible services, with ADA-compliant features on most buses, trains, and stations. However, navigating the system requires planning, especially for individuals with mobility limitations.

**Ride-Share and Medical Transport: Beyond the Basics**

Ride-sharing services, such as Uber and Lyft, offer a convenient, albeit often more expensive, option. They provide door-to-door service, eliminating the need to navigate public transit or find parking. This is particularly beneficial for patients undergoing treatment that may leave them fatigued or with limited mobility. The availability of these services is generally excellent in 19109, with wait times typically short.

For individuals requiring specialized medical transportation, several companies operate in Philadelphia. These services, often covered by insurance, provide non-emergency medical transportation (NEMT) for appointments and treatments. Companies like Liberty Transportation and Medical Transportation Management (MTM) offer services tailored to the needs of patients with mobility issues or other medical requirements. Booking these services in advance is crucial, especially during peak hours.
